Title : Off-vertical rotation produces conditioned taste aversion and suppressed drinking in mice.

2 The greater suppression of tap water intake and the stronger conditioned aversion in the mouse as the angle of tilt was increased in this experiment are consistent with predictions from similar experiments with human subjects where motion sickness develops more rapidly as the angle of tilt is increased.
